Original abstract
This article deals with the modeling of the dynamic multibody analysis of the driving motion of transport equipment. The transport machine has a design concept of the two frames. The frames are connected by joints. The machine is driven hydraulically in the joint. On both frames are boogie axles with eight wheels. The machine is used by two technological modes. The simulation is performed on the driving mode and the mode for loading of the mobile crane. The program MSC Adams 2010 is used for the analysis of the dynamic behavior of the virtual prototype wheeled transport machinery. Simulation of the virtual prototype machine is not expensive and is quite precise to the design construction assemblies. The values found in dynamic simulation are input parameters for the FEM structural analysis of the assemblies.
